Exploring the Order

For years, the Order has existed as a wellspring of mystery, conjuring ideas of hidden power and global influence. Originally, founded in Bavaria in 1776, this reason-era society sought to challenge superstition and corruption of power, but its short existence was cut short by state suppression. Currently, the contemporary-day understanding of the Order is vastly distinct its historical beginnings, fueled by shadowy theories and popular culture. Common marks, such as the observant eye within a triangle, and the nocturnal creature, are often interpreted as markers of this elusive organization, contributing to the ambiance of privacy that surrounds it. Whether real or purely mythological, the Order continues to capture the fancy of people globally.

Can Such Reside: Delving The copyright Narrative

The age-old question of whether the copyright, a group long associated with conspiracy dealings, is actually real in the modern era continues to ignite countless online discussions and speculative theories. While the original Bavarian copyright was a short-lived 18th-century enlightenment-era society, the modern narrative often portrays it as a dominant organization secretly controlling world events. Evidence tends to be sparse and often relies on distortions of historical events, symbolic imagery, and dubious connections. Several claim to see signs of the copyright in everything from financial logos to governmental decisions, but critics argue that these are simply examples of confirmation bias – the tendency to find meaningful patterns where none exist. Ultimately, the modern copyright narrative is more a popular phenomenon than a concrete reality, reflecting anxieties about power, control, and the intricacy of the world around us.
